A culinary bachelor's degree generally takes four years of full-time study to complete, while an associate degree takes two years full time. Associate degrees typically take two years, bachelor's degrees take four years, master's degrees take an additional one to two years and doctoral degrees take at least two years to earn. Typical costs: A culinary arts certificate or diploma program typically costs $17,550-$47,000 and lasts seven to 12 months with 600-1,000 combined hours of classroom and hands-on .
